Understanding Chelant A Deep Dive into Its Importance and Applications


Chelants are fascinating chemical compounds that play a crucial role in a variety of applications, from agriculture to medicine. The term chelant derives from the Greek word chélê, meaning claw, which aptly describes how these molecules interact with metal ions. By forming stable complexes with metals, chelants facilitate numerous processes essential for both environmental and human health.

In the realm of environmental science, chelants are utilized for remediation purposes. Heavy metal contamination from industrial processes can have devastating effects on ecosystems and human health. Chelation therapy aids in the extraction of harmful metals like lead, mercury, and cadmium from contaminated soil and water, making these environments safer. By binding to these toxic metals and aiding their removal, chelants not only protect the environment but also help restore it to a healthier state.

Medicinal applications of chelants are equally significant. In the medical field, chelation therapy is often used to treat heavy metal toxicity. Conditions caused by excessive metal accumulation, such as lead poisoning, can be remedied by administering chelating agents that bind to the metals in the bloodstream. This process facilitates their excretion, thereby alleviating the adverse health effects associated with heavy metal toxicity. Chelation therapy is also being researched for its potential benefits in treating diseases such as Alzheimer’s, where metal accumulation may play a role in disease progression.


Furthermore, the importance of chelants stretches into the realm of industrial processes. In various manufacturing sectors, chelating agents are used to control metal ion content in solutions, preventing unwanted reactions that can compromise product quality. Their ability to sequester metal ions also enhances the efficiency of many industrial processes, leading to cost savings and environmental benefits.


However, the use of chelants is not without controversy. Some synthetic chelating agents have raised environmental concerns regarding their biodegradability and potential toxicity. This has sparked research into developing greener alternatives, such as biodegradable chelants derived from natural sources. These alternatives promise to deliver the same benefits without the long-term ecological risks associated with traditional chelating agents.


In summary, chelants are indispensable in various fields, serving critical roles in agriculture, environmental remediation, medicine, and industry. As the global community faces increasing challenges related to food security, environmental pollution, and health, the importance of chelants will only continue to grow. The ongoing research into more sustainable and effective chelating agents reflects our commitment to harnessing the benefits of these compounds while safeguarding our planet for future generations. Understanding and advancing the science of chelation will undoubtedly unlock new possibilities that contribute to a healthier and more sustainable world.
